WhatsApp: +86 18221755073Titanium pigments were made originally by dissolving ilmenite in sulfuric acid, crystallizing to separate iron, then hydrolyzing the solution and calcining the precipitate. WhatsApp: +86 18221755073Titanium and iron are closely related in nature, although titanium is the ninth most abundant element in the Earth's crust. Iron in titanium ores must be removed for use as feedstocks in the manufacture of titanium dioxide pigments and pure TiCl4 for metal titanium. WhatsApp: +86 18221755073To develop a flowsheet for separation of high grade titanium-rutile from ilmenite, that will meet market requirements. Rutile has a SG of 4.2, hardness 6.0 to 6.5 and is non-magnetic; while ilmenite has a SG of 4.5 to 5.0, hardness of 5.0 to 6.0, and is weakly magnetic.
